Abstract

The development, manufacture, performance test, and installation of an industrial or utility cable that utilizes a new-generation tree-retardant insulation is reviewed in detail. The insulation material used for this cable offers improved resistance to dielectric aging caused by water-tree formation. Detailed data showing improvement over conventional cross-lined polyethylene (XLPE) is reviewed. Association of Edison Illuminating Companies (AEIC) -5 qualification data on full-size cables will also be reviewed. A typical installation involving replacement of an industrial cable using the tree-retardant insulation will be described.
